I have 200 and my little light under the front of the Devialet is always white when it is on.

According info from Devialet page it says:

The small orange light placed under the front of the Devialet appears when the amplifier is on. It turns to red when no valid signal is received from a digital source.

So what is going on? My Devialet light is not changing colors because is bad working or this orange/red light is only for D-Premier or 250?

What are Your light colors friends?
Mine is as per Devialet statement, orange unless no digital signal when it is red.
Devialet 200, always white.
D200, white
Thank You for answering! So it looks that 200 must be always white;-) So mine Devialet is ok, no any malfunction.
